I haven't had an issue before? My collections are marked as thus through MCM and each collections folder has [boxset] at the end of the folder titles. This has always worked fine.

 

Emby stopped honoring legacy [boxset] folders within the library a long time ago and only honors virtual collections that reside in "\Emby-Server\programdata\data\collections" (OS local is slightly different on every OS).

 

Since you said web app will not group either I would suspect this is the issue.

 

 

I use MCM also but Emby will not honor that structure any more except folder view.  That collection folder is treated as a normal folder.
